MethylPace is an advanced tool that evaluates biological ageing using epigenetic methylation markers. Unlike chronological age, which simply reflects years lived, biological age offers a more accurate measure of cellular health.

 

This analysis focuses on 10 key genes strongly associated with ageing. By examining these genes, MethylPace provides a precise estimate of biological age and offers personalised health insights to support longevity.

Immunoscore* Additional Epigenetic Reports

Understand how your immune system is regulated

 

DNA methylation plays a vital role in immune function by controlling gene expression, immune cell differentiation, and cytokine production.

 

Immunoscore analyses methylation patterns linked to immune health and potential autoimmune disorders. It also highlights the role of immunological memory, which allows for faster and more effective responses to previously encountered pathogens. This insight can help you maintain immune resilience and improve disease defence.

Inflammation* Additional Epigenetic Reports

Discover how inflammation impacts ageing and health

 

Chronic inflammation is a key driver of ageing and is linked to conditions such as cardiovascular disease, diabetes, neurodegenerative disorders, and autoimmune diseases.

 

Our test evaluates the methylation of genes involved in inflammatory pathways, providing a personalised inflammation profile:

  • Pro-Inflammation Score
  • Anti-Inflammatory Score
  • Overall Inflammation Score

Identifying areas of high inflammation allows you to make targeted lifestyle changes such as optimising diet and reducing environmental stressors to improve overall health.

Muscle Degenaration* Additional Epigenetic Reports

Understand how ageing impacts muscle health

 

Muscle degeneration, or sarcopenia, is the loss of muscle mass, strength, and function associated with ageing.

 

Poor methylation can impair protein synthesis, muscle growth, repair, and maintenance leading to increased degeneration and a decline in physical performance. By identifying genetic factors influencing muscle health, you can take proactive steps to support muscle strength and recovery.
